Key Features of the Toyota bZ Space Concept
The Toyota bZ Space Concept isn’t just about looking good; it’s packed with features that aim to revolutionize the driving experience. Let's break down some of the standout elements that make this concept car so intriguing. One of the most noticeable features is its spacious interior. Toyota has gone to great lengths to maximize the cabin space, creating a roomy and comfortable environment for all occupants. This is achieved through clever design elements, such as a flat floor, slim seats, and a panoramic glass roof that enhances the sense of openness. Imagine sitting in a car where you don't feel cramped or confined, even on long journeys. That’s the promise of the bZ Space Concept.
Next up, let’s talk about technology. The bZ Space Concept is equipped with a suite of advanced tech features designed to make your life easier and more enjoyable. The infotainment system is intuitive and user-friendly, providing seamless access to navigation, entertainment, and vehicle information. There's also a focus on connectivity, allowing you to stay connected to the outside world while on the road. Features like wireless charging, smartphone integration, and over-the-air updates ensure that you're always up-to-date and ready to go. But it’s not just about entertainment and convenience. The bZ Space Concept also incorporates advanced safety features, such as driver-assistance systems, automatic emergency braking, and lane-keeping assist. These technologies work together to help prevent accidents and keep you and your passengers safe. Finally, the bZ Space Concept boasts a sustainable design, with a focus on using eco-friendly materials and minimizing its environmental impact. From the recycled plastics in the interior to the efficient electric powertrain, every aspect of the car is designed with sustainability in mind. This commitment to sustainability reflects Toyota’s broader vision of creating a greener and more sustainable future for the automotive industry.

The Future of Car Interiors
The Toyota bZ Space Concept offers a tantalizing glimpse into the future of car interiors. As technology advances and consumer preferences evolve, we can expect to see even more innovation in the way cars are designed and equipped. One of the key trends that is likely to shape the future of car interiors is the increasing focus on personalization. In the future, cars will be able to adapt to the individual needs and preferences of their occupants, offering customized settings for everything from seat position and climate control to entertainment and lighting. This level of personalization will create a more comfortable and enjoyable driving experience, as well as enhance safety and convenience.
Another trend that is likely to influence the future of car interiors is the integration of advanced technology. We can expect to see even more sophisticated infotainment systems, driver-assistance systems, and connectivity features in the cars of tomorrow. These technologies will not only make driving easier and safer but also provide a range of new entertainment and communication options. For example, cars may be equipped with augmented reality displays that overlay information onto the windshield, providing real-time navigation and hazard alerts. They may also feature voice-activated controls that allow you to operate various functions without taking your hands off the wheel. In addition to personalization and technology, sustainability will also play a key role in the future of car interiors. Automakers will increasingly focus on using sustainable materials, minimizing waste, and reducing the carbon footprint of their vehicles. This will involve the use of recycled plastics, bio-based materials, and lightweight construction techniques. By prioritizing sustainability, automakers can help create a more environmentally friendly future for the automotive industry.
